High degree of dampness and fungus

In areas with high rainfall and high humidity, the appearance of dampness in any building is possible. In a frame house, the risk is somewhat greater, since a very accurate calculation of the "dew point" is required, borderline between the different temperature background of the street and the house.

If this point is incorrectly calculated, condensation occurs, followed by fungus and mold, but this can only happen when the premises are completely sealed, when the walls do not "breathe" and moisture does not come out. When building the walls of frame houses, a properly assembled "sandwich" is of great importance, processing wooden structures antiseptic that protects against fungus and pest beetles. A properly built and carefully treated house with antiseptics, fungus, mold and pests will not be scary for many years.

Rapid erection and all-season construction

These are some of the most significant advantages of frame houses. Largely thanks to them, frame structures have long been recognized in the West and have already come to the liking of a wide range of domestic developers. For example, a box of a medium-sized one-story private residential building can be assembled on a pre-prepared foundation in just a day! Of course, we are talking about pre-assembled panels. But even if the walls and ceilings are completely manufactured at the construction site, the speed of their construction is still quite high. So, the construction of a medium frame house turnkey from zero cycle to the start of operation takes time, in the case of assembly:

  • from finished factory panels - 2-3 months;
  • from materials at the construction site - 4-5 months.

At the same time, the installation of enclosing structures can be carried out all year round, since there are no "wet" processes. The only exceptions are monolithic foundations, but they can often be replaced with screw piles.

Application of lightweight foundations

Noticeable savings in the total estimated cost of the structure are accounted for by the foundation. Indeed, due to the low mass of the building, no material-intensive foundations are required for its installation. For example, the most popular frame houses with a skeleton made of a board of 50 * 150 mm are characterized by a specific gravity wall panels 30-50 kg / m 2. For comparison, brickwork reduced to a thickness of 150 mm is 200-250 kg / m 2. If we take into account that in reality external brick walls are rarely less than 380 mm or 510 mm, then the difference in the masses of brick and frame houses is already huge. And this is not even taking into account the excellent loads from heavy hollow-core reinforced concrete floors in brick and on wooden beams in the frame structure.

Based on the low requirements for the bearing capacity of the base, frame frames can be installed on any of the known types of foundations. Limitations of the variability of choice can only be on the part of overly problematic soils. In all other cases, the type of foundation is selected, guided by the characteristics of a particular building, local conditions or the availability of materials. For example, a one-story frame house can be installed on block posts, screw piles or reinforced concrete tape with a width of only 250 mm.

Insufficient or gradually decreasing thermal efficiency of the enclosing structures

One of the problems due to which interest in frame-panel houses was somewhat lost in the past. Unfortunately, she still occurs today. The reasons are as follows:

  • the thickness of the wall or floor panels, and accordingly the insulation in them, does not correspond to local climatic conditions... For example, a layer of effective thermal insulation of 100 mm (mineral wool, expanded polystyrene) can be considered as a sufficient thermal barrier only in the walls. garden house, and even then, located in the temperate zone;
  • poorly fitted or weakly tightened structural elements, insufficiently sealed joints of frame parts, windproof sheets or sheathing sheets - these technological violations cause through blows. Similar disadvantages of frame houses can also appear as a result of intense shrinkage of buildings or its deformations, as a consequence of the use of lumber of natural moisture. Shrinkage of wood leads to the disclosure of interfaces in structures;
  • violation of the integrity of the vapor barrier, the wrong choice of materials for it or its incorrect installation - contribute to the rapid damping of the insulation. Wet thermal insulation not only ceases to fulfill the tasks assigned to it, but also becomes a hotbed of putrefactive processes that destroy the load-bearing elements;
  • subsidence (creeping) of the insulating filler of wall panels, due to which an area with weakened energy efficiency is formed in their upper part. This usually happens if low density rockwool is selected, but sufficient measures are not taken to fix it;
  • damage to the thermal insulation of a frame house by rodents sometimes becomes a really serious problem. To prevent it from arising, you should try to make it difficult for pests to penetrate into the panels or discourage them from such a desire. For this, for example, ventilated facades are protected from below with metal gratings or nets. If the cladding is "wet", then a good solution would be to install Aquapanel Knauf or DSP slabs plastered on a steel mesh. In addition, various chemical impregnations and ultrasonic devices are used to scare off rodents. A couple of cats on the site will also help to significantly reduce the risk of mice or rats spoiling the insulation.

High fire hazard

This disadvantage of frame houses is rather relative. However, in any case, it is no more significant than that of traditional solid wood structures. After all, even if the building envelopes are assembled on wooden frame with foam filler, then from the outside they can be sheathed with sheets of drywall or glass-magnesia plates. Such a lining reliably blocks the access of an open flame to combustible materials. In addition, building codes require initially combustible materials to be flame retardant at the factory or on site.

Important! If a frame made of a metal profile with a mineral wool filler is mounted, then its fire resistance can already be commensurate with a stone structure.

Fire safety issues also affect electrical installation. PUE regulates the laying of electrical wiring on combustible structures open way either hidden in metal pipes or sleeves.

The key factor in the durability of the frame is the hydrophobization and antiseptic treatment of the structural materials of its walls and ceilings in parts placed no higher than 250 mm from the ground. For internal elements made of wood, processing is carried out at the stage of erection of the building, as well as during repairs when opening the paneling. Preparation of beams, posts, crossbars, lintels, etc. on construction sites it is carried out by painting or dipping them in a container with a working solution. Today, as such solutions, compositions are often used complex action, which are simultaneously water repellents, fire retardants and antiseptics. Parts of the frame that are above 250 mm from the ground do not require mandatory treatment with antiseptics (SP 31-105-2002).

It will be possible to fully use the advantages of a frame house for many years, if moisture in any form from entering the panels is avoided. For example, water can seep through a damaged roof deck, rise through the foundation capillaries through a broken shut-off waterproofing, or migrate with steam flows from the room through poorly glued joints of the vapor barrier. If this happens, then you should remove the casing, remove the insulating filler and thoroughly dry the frame. Heat insulating material it is dried separately, but sometimes it is better to renew it altogether.

Before reassembling the panels, the frame elements must undergo mandatory protective and preventive treatment:

  • parts subjected to biological damage or corrosion are cleaned, and in case of significant destruction, they are replaced;
  • wood parts are impregnated with compounds of complex action, steel parts are treated with anticorrosive materials, then they are zinc-plated or painted.

Soundproofing problems

Although this minus of a frame house is given, often, comparing it with a brick building, one should clearly understand what is at stake. Of course, a thick brick mass with identical thermal conductivity frame wall better insulates against street noise. However, its intensity in the places of the predominant placement of skeletons is not so high. After all, they are usually erected not in urban centers, but in cottage settlements, the private sector or the countryside.

The problem of internal noise remains. And in this matter, everything again depends on the observance of the installation rules and the materials used. For example, in order not to listen to the conversations of people on the other floor:

  • on the ceilings are equipped floor coverings on the system of "floating floors";
  • filling of ceilings or partitions should be carried out only with fibrous materials with special acoustic parameters;
  • air cavities in ceilings, walls, partitions are not allowed;
  • conjugation of structures is performed through elements of acoustic interconnections in the form of elastic spacers or interlayers of latex, cork, porous rubber, etc.

The urgent need for ventilation

The ideal frame house is a thermos with zero heat loss. In practice, by choosing the appropriate building materials and performing high-quality assembly from them, you can come close to the theoretically possible minimum heat loss through the enclosing structures. However, in any case, there will remain one more problem area in the thermal circuit of the building, through which significant amounts of energy will go. This is a ventilation system. After all, you can still do without it in a log house or a brick structure, where the walls are directly involved in steam, gas and heat exchange in the premises. But in the frame, where under the inner lining there is a continuous vapor-proof carpet over a layer of insulation, there is no way without ventilation.

And no matter how sorry it may be to blow out precious calories along with the air currents into the street in winter, if the required level of gas exchange is not ensured, then serious problems cannot be avoided. Among other things, the negative caused by the lack of fresh air, the accumulating dampness will gradually find a loophole in the vapor barrier. The vapor, migrating through the insulation from the room to the street, will cool in the outer layers of the enclosing structures, falling out into condensation. The result is a decrease in the effectiveness of thermal insulation, rotting (rusting) of the frame, the development of harmful mold microflora.

Therefore, the urgent need for ventilation can be considered both a plus and a minus of a frame house. After all, on the one hand, it will no longer be possible to ignore this important issue, which means that there will always be a healthy atmosphere in the premises. On the other hand, you will have to choose one of two options:

  1. Increase energy consumption to compensate for heat loss for ventilation. This is a rather dubious method, since the high thermal efficiency of the enclosing structures is practically nullified.
  2. Install an integrated climate system complete with air heating, recuperation and air conditioning units. Despite the fact that such devices cost a lot, they gradually pay off and begin to save energy. In extreme cases, you can at least mount a recuperator on the supply and exhaust ventilation system.
